Q: Is 7,718,350 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 7,718,350 is a composite number.

Why is 7,718,350 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 7,718,350 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 25 29 50 58 145 290 725 1,450 5,323 10,646 26,615 53,230 133,075 154,367 266,150 308,734 771,835 1,543,670 3,859,175 and 7,718,350, with no remainder.

Since 7,718,350 cannot be divided by just 1 and 7,718,350, it is a composite number.
